Parker’s Hires Director of Fuel Services

Jeff Bush

SAVANNAH, Ga. -- Parker's Corp. named Jeff Bush its director of fuel services.

Bush is responsible for overseeing fuel logistics, pricing strategies, supply costs and supplier negotiations for the operator of 30 convenience stores. He previously served as business manager for Armstrong Atlantic State University's newspaper, The Inkwell.

Bush also served as a forward observer for the U.S. Army, and quickly rose to the rank of staff sergeant. During his military service, Bush earned the Combat Action Badge, Iraqi Campaign Medal and 14 other awards and medals.

"Jeff's military background, commitment to excellence and attention to detail make him an excellent addition to the Parker's team," said Parker's President and CEO Greg Parker. "I met him when I spoke to students at Armstrong Atlantic State University last year and was immediately impressed by his enthusiasm."

Bush, a resident of Hinesville, Ga., is completing a Bachelor of Arts in Economics at Armstrong Atlantic.

Savannah, Ga.-based Parker's Corp. operates c-stores throughout Georgia and South Carolina.
